如何用指令使PLC一直輸出脈衝的方法
時間:2019-10-19 08:33 來源:ob体育竞彩
讓PLC輸出脈衝的方法還是比較多的,我們可以根據控製不同的負載,通過不同的指令輸出脈衝的頻率是不一樣的。下麵我們以日係PLC(可編程控製器)與各位朋友說說如何用指令使PLC一直輸出脈衝的方法。
下麵用基本指令給朋友們介紹一下PLC輸出脈衝的一些基本方法,比如我們可以用輔助繼電器M0來產生一個掃描周期的脈衝,如下圖所示。如果X0閉合,第一次掃描到M0常閉觸點的時候,M0線圈會得電。第二次從頭開始掃描,當掃描到M0的常閉觸點時,由於M0線圈得電後,常閉觸點已經斷開,所以M0線圈失電,這樣說來M0線圈得電為一個掃描周期,就這樣M0線圈連續不斷地得電、失電,這樣如果與輸出繼電器Y0相連,就會讓PLC輸出連續不斷的脈衝
當然我們也可以用定時器來實現PLC脈衝的不斷輸出,當輔助繼電器M8000閉合的時候,由於定時器T1時間沒到,它的動斷觸點是閉合的,Y0輸出為高電平,當T1的定時到了後,Y0變為低電平,T1的常開觸點閉合時T0開始計時,當T0時間到後,其常閉觸點複位,又使T1開始計時,這時Y0又為高電平,就這樣如此循環,達到了PLC輸出脈衝的目的
我們還可以用PLC內部的特殊輔助繼電器來實現脈衝的輸出,比如M8013是一秒的脈衝時鍾,如下圖所示。當M8000為ON時,輸出繼電器Y0就會以0.5秒為高電平、0.5秒為低電平,這樣反複輸出以周期為1秒的脈衝。類似這樣的特殊輔助繼電器還有M8011周期為10毫秒的輸出脈衝、M8012周期為100毫秒的輸出脈衝、M8014為1分鍾周期的輸出脈衝等。
以上我們說的PLC脈衝輸出要麼頻率很高、要麼頻率很低,我們要對一些特殊負載進行控製,那麼我們還可以用這樣的指令來控製伺服電機或步進電機,如下圖所示。
當X0閉合時,就會將指令中的數據K12000傳送到存儲器D中,這時候M0常開觸點會閉合,Y0會在頻率為1000HZ下執行存儲器D0裏麵的數據,因此PLC就會有高速脈衝輸出。所以我們用[PLSY K1000 D0 Y0]這條脈衝輸出功能指令也可以達到目的。其它品牌的PLC也可以實現連續的脈衝輸出,
看過《如何用指令使PLC一直輸出脈衝的方法》的人還看了以下文章
|
如何用觸摸屏改PLC輸出 |
廠裏用的omron的plc,連接的是威綸觸摸屏. 輸出點有時壞掉的情況下,我不用電腦改輸出點,用觸摸屏怎麼改換輸出點? 這個問題有點異想,經不起細敲,外部接線能保證更改正確木,可以的話; 1.換歐姆龍帶編程器的屏---當然還是要改動程序嘍,能保證改動正確,... |
|
三菱plc時間繼電器指令k1為幾秒 |
三菱PLC時間繼電器從0到200它的時間是毫秒級別計算的,具體的要查看plc時間,繼電器的指令原件的功能,第一是代表的,要看它單位前麵踢代碼是哪一個就相對應的時間,如t1k1就代表0.1毫秒... |
|
西門子plc1500用什麼指令怎麼二進製轉換成 |
沒有專門的指令,你可以自己寫一個二進製轉十進製的功能: 以字節例如:二進製存儲在MB10,十進製存儲在MB11, MB11=M10.7*2^7+M10.6*2^6+M10.5*2^5+M10.4*2^4+M10.3*2^3+M10.2*2^2+M10.1*2^1+M10.0*2^0 功能中的加減乘除用相應的功能塊去轉換。... |
|
PLC同步和異步掃描指令的區別 |
同步和異步: 同步和異步這兩詞在不同場合出現,其意義也不同。同步和異步,首先要理解是與誰同步及與誰不同步(異步)。例如,與PLC掃描周期同步及與PLC掃描周期不同步(異步): 在PLC編程中就有同步邏輯和異步邏輯。即,由一些指令組成的邏輯在一個PLC掃... |
|
PLC發送的指令怎麼讓軟件接收到 |
首先得了解通訊硬件上的一些常識。 比如常見到的通訊方式還是很多的,有RS232,RS485,USB等等。 可以事先對這些常用的通訊作一個了解。 自己硬件上的端口確認是RS232還是RS485,或是網口。 得保證通訊的兩個硬件能夠連接上。 例如我們常會見到PLC的端口為RS... |